Tooth Decay Avoidance
To stop dental caries, you need to exercise great dental health behaviors and make routine check outs to the dental practitioner.
- Brush your teeth twice a day with fluoride tooth paste, seeing to it to clean all surfaces of your teeth and gums.
- Bear in mind to replace your tooth brush every three to four months or quicker if the bristles come to be torn.
- Flossing daily is also vital to eliminate plaque and food fragments from between the teeth.
- Stay clear of sweet and acidic foods and drinks, as they can contribute to dental cavity.
- Instead, pick nourishing foods like fruits, veggies, and milk products that promote oral health.
- Lastly, ensure to set up regular oral exams and cleanings to capture any kind of potential oral troubles early and preserve a healthy smile.
Gum Tissue Condition Avoidance
Preserving good dental hygiene behaviors and regular dental check outs not only avoid dental cavity, but also play an important role in stopping gum condition. Gum tissue disease, likewise known as periodontal illness, is a common trouble that affects the gums and cells surrounding the teeth.
To maintain your gum tissues healthy and protect against periodontal illness, here are a couple of easy steps you can take:
- Brush your teeth two times a day with a fluoride toothpaste.
- Floss daily to eliminate plaque and food fragments from in between your teeth.
- Use an antibacterial mouth wash to lower microorganisms in your mouth.
- Consume a well balanced diet plan and limitation sweet snacks and drinks.
